What does "certain" mean?
-
adj Completely confident that something is true.
"She was certain she had locked the door."
-
adj Sure to happen; inevitable.
"A recession now seems almost certain."
-
det Used to refer to a specific but unnamed person or thing.
"Certain foods can trigger an allergic reaction."
